problem 4: lesson 41) complete this sentence with the best of the choices given. a(n) __________ of a triangle is a segment drawn from any vertex of the triangle to the midpoint of the opposite side. after you pick your answer press go. a. hypotenuse b. median c. midline d. altitude e. perpendicular
By definition, a median of a triangle is a segment from a vertex to the mid - point of the opposite side. Other options have different geometric definitions. For example, the hypotenuse is the longest side of a right - triangle, the midline is parallel to a side of the triangle, the altitude is perpendicular from a vertex to the opposite side, and a perpendicular is a line at a 90 - degree angle.
